To hear Mercedes describe it, the EQS is the S-Class of the electric car world, as opposed to being an electric S-Class. It’s the first Mercedes designed from the outset as an electric vehicle (EV), which is material, because it means it was optimised for the typical EV layout that has all the batteries under the floor.
This one, the EQS 450+, kicks off the range with a single rear motor, while the twin-motor Mercedes-AMG 53 version, with all of 761 horsepower to its name, is the one to buy if you’re both eco-minded and a performance junkie.
